Van Ness is NOT another Gary, Van Ness is a more athletic and longer OLB Kevin Greene...

He only has one move (the bull rush) but he'll consistently put guys in their @sses with it... though in this day and error, he seriously needs more moves, but if you are only going to have one great move to work other things off of, I think it's the bull rush.

He'll absolutely be an Edge Rusher, I'm sure he could still come on the inside for pass rush downs, but we just drafted DT Wyatt for that DT pass rush role.


Van Ness mainly needs more experience and more guys pushing him, as he probably jait stuck with the bull rush because not enough college guys could stop it. Run into more guys that can stop it (especially when they know it's coming over and over again) then he'll finally learn to mix other moves in too.

Looking at Preston Smith contract, he's probably here for at least two more years. And one would assume they'll resign Gary long term if he gets healthy.


Gary, Wyatt, Clark and Van Ness


Also, with the Packers currently coverage heavy scheme of often dropping 7 into coverage, those front four are asked to do a hell lot and you need a dominant DL with this scheme.
